Barkelona offers an immersive and engaging environment for Spanish learners to practice vocabulary, conversation, and reading skills. Its focus on exploration and interaction with diverse characters fosters communication and empathy, making language acquisition an enjoyable and effective experience.

How long should kids play Barkelona?

Our session recommendation for Barkelona is up to 120 minutes per day. It is derived from the game's own structure (natural stopping points, compulsion-loop design, monetization pressure, and social dynamics), not from a universal screen-time dose.

Session recommendations are design-based heuristics. Evidence linking specific daily durations to child outcomes is limited, and context matters as much as time; treat this as a starting point for household rules, not a clinical threshold.
